
Jack Da Silva
Dr. Jack Da Silva is a senior lecturer at the University of Adelaide who studies the health and longevity of dogs, particularly focusing on why larger breeds tend to have shorter lifespans due to higher cancer rates. His insights contribute to the understanding of canine biology and the potential for improving the health of dogs through scientific research.
